Output 84edd30de260a88bc38ba313bc022f0f87335844a97feb7b444225dad10952b6:59

value
1276935
script pubkey
OP_0 OP_PUSHBYTES_20 cb5a0b64110eea1572755e2f5c94e8948f58ea38
address
bc1qeddqkeq3pm4p2un4tch4e98gjj84363cwfqkx0
transaction
84edd30de260a88bc38ba313bc022f0f87335844a97feb7b444225dad10952b6
spent
true